大家好,今天咱们来聊聊怎么用技术手段做一个“科研项目管理系统”,特别是针对新乡这个地方的。其实吧,这个系统说白了就是用来管理科研项目的进度、人员、经费这些信息的。
先说说技术选型。我选的是Python作为后端语言,因为Python语法简单,而且有很多现成的框架可以用,比如Django或者Flask。然后数据库方面,我用了MySQL,毕竟它稳定,适合做数据存储。

接下来是代码部分。下面是一个简单的例子,展示怎么用Python和Flask创建一个项目列表页面。当然,这只是一个基础版本,实际应用中可能还需要权限控制、用户登录等功能。
from flask import Flask, render_template
import mysql.connector
app = Flask(__name__)
# 连接数据库
db = mysql.connector.connect(
host="localhost",
user="root",
password="123456",
database="research_db"
)
@app.route('/')
def index():
cursor = db.cursor()
cursor.execute("SELECT * FROM projects")
projects = cursor.fetchall()
return render_template('index.html', projects=projects)
if __name__ == '__main__':
app.run(debug=True)
这段代码只是从数据库里取出所有项目,并渲染到前端页面上。如果你是新乡的开发者,可以考虑把这个系统部署在本地服务器上,方便团队协作。
总结一下,科研项目管理系统并不复杂,只要选对工具,加上一点编程基础,就能快速搭建出来。希望这篇文章能帮到你,尤其是新乡的朋友,一起搞点技术吧!
本站部分内容及素材来源于互联网,如有侵权,联系必删!
标签:
科研系统
客服经理